About SNAP benefits

If you qualify for SNAP benefits, you’ll receive a Lone Star Card—an EBT card that can be used at most medium and large grocery stores to help you buy groceries.

SNAP (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program), formerly known as food stamps, provides financial assistance to low-income individuals and families to purchase food.
